CLAN?  WHAT CLAN?

What truly separates the Caitiff from their fellow kindred is their
lack of a Clan, and yet they are considered to be Camarilla vampires 
as well (see recent post).  They do not have Hunting Grounds available 
to them unless accompanied by another who has a Clan affiliation, and 
have very few cards to help them as well.  The bonus to the Caitiff is 
their wide range of Disciplines.  If you are making a deck based on a 
clan, but are one or two shy of where you truly want to be, you can 
always throw in a Caitiff with some common disciplines, but we will 
get in to that in Deck De-Construction.

DECK DE-CONSTRUCTION

Not too many decks out there have just Caitiff, I wouldn't mind getting
sent a couple so I can comment on them!  In the mean time I will talk about
everybody's favourite concept. weenie bleed!!!  There are a couple of
Caitiff that fit the Weenie Bleed format perfectly, Antoinette DuChamp,
Igo the Hungry, and even Navar McLaren. Navar you say?  Antoinette and Igo
are a given with their "pre", but Navar?  I have seen the damage caused by a
Weenie Bleed deck spattered with Army of Rats and I tell you it wasn't
pretty.  I know that it isn't cumulative but one pool a turn can hurt
if not countered by a Hunting Ground/Blood Doll or equivalent.

VAMP OF THE HOUR

Hasina Kesi

Can anyone say Immortal Grapple?  There's only one thing better than a
1-cap Vamp with "pot", and that's a 2-cap vamp with "pot".  She can't
decapitate, but she can Disarm after an Undead Strength/Torn Signpost, 
and that's a disgusting way to get rid of bloat.  Sure, you risk burning 
a pool if she goes to torpor, but the trade-off is worth it.  Plus, she 
can do this turn two for you if someone TORIII's a fatty out on you.
